A fashion house in the Spanish city of Bilbao has sparked controversy on the Internet, after news broke that it had begun to charge a fee of $ 17 to wear the suits it was designing.

Pascual Bilbao Tailoring has been designing men's suits and evening wear for 40 years, so it no longer needs more reputation. This skill, acquired by Camino Azula Pascual and her brother Carlos, over four decades, can no longer be wasted on people who do not want to buy effectively, which is why starting from this year, fees began to apply to everyone looking to wear suits in the store, for a few minutes of experience .

Pascual says: "Many people come several times, alone, with their parents, or with their grandmothers or friends, and they ask for advice on styles, models and accessories, and then they go to another place to buy." "Some of them are worse than that, as they take advantage of all the advice they receive in our store to buy a cheaper suit online."

Professional sewing explains: “Every appointment with a customer can last two hours, on average, and we already know that no one can guarantee us a sale, but in this way (charging) we know at least that the people who visit us have a true awareness of the value we offer. ».

The price of men's suits in "Pascual Bilbao Tailoring" can range between 960 and 1,800 dollars, so the two brothers are confident that everyone who really wants to buy one of their creations will not be disbursed away for a fee of $ 17, in addition, for people who decide to buy at the end Ultimately, the fees are deducted from the invoice, so they only pay for clothes and accessories.

"We want to teach people that if we charge these fees, it is because the service we provide is of the highest quality," Pascual said.
